Main duties of the job

You will:

* provide support in the delivery of a quality homecare medicines supply service to patients under the care of the homecare service in Bradford.
* provide a link between the specialties and the homecare services team to improve the timely prescribing, ordering and supply of patients' medication to reduce both wastage or missed doses of treatment.
* maintain the safe, efficient and cost-effective supply of homecare medicines to patients under the care of the Trust
* To provide routine advice to patients/carers on pharmaceutical products and further supplies including liaison with prescribers and pharmacy professionals.

Person Specification


Experience

* Significant experience of Technical pharmacy service delivery post qualification acquired through NVQ3 in Pharmacy Services or BTEC equivalent level qualification plus specialist training and experience to degree or equivalent level.
* Experience of working in a similar role
* Experience of working in homecare services
* Experience of supervising staff including basic HR advice
* Member of the Association of Pharmacy Technicians UK


Skills

* Ability to follow written and verbal instructions
* Ability to work effectively under pressure
* Good team working skills
* Demonstrable attention to detail


Knowledge

* Knowledge of Medicines Management
* Knowledge and understanding of Pharmaceutical technical procedures specific to the area of work


Qualifications

* Level 3 Diploma in Pharmacy Services Skills (NVQ) or equivalent qualification
* Registered as a Pharmacy Technician with the General Pharmaceutical Council (GPhC)


other requirements

* Demonstrates continued professional development or equivalent knowledge through experience
* Excellent physical fitness and good general health
* Flexibility in working hours to suit the needs of the department


Disclosure and Barring Service Check

This post is subject to the Rehabilitation of Offenders Act (Exceptions Order) 1975 and as such it will be necessary for a submission for Disclosure to be made to the Disclosure and Barring Service (formerly known as CRB) to check for any previous criminal convictions.
